Product Overview: ADG1433YRUZ-REEL7 by Analog Devices Inc.
The ADG1433YRUZ-REEL7 is a high-performance, monolithic CMOS device comprising triple single-pole/double-throw (SPDT) switches, designed and manufactured by Analog Devices Inc. This innovative component is a quintessential solution for a multitude of applications that require efficient and reliable switching capabilities.
Key Features
- Low On-Resistance: The device boasts an ultra-low on-resistance (Ron) typically around 2.5 ohms, ensuring minimal signal distortion and power loss during operation.
- Wide Operating Voltage Range: It operates across a broad voltage range from ±5 V to ±16.5 V or a single supply of 10 V to 16.5 V, providing versatility in different circuit configurations.
- High Current Carrying Capability: The switch can handle continuous current up to ±200 mA, making it suitable for applications with higher current demands.
- Extended Temperature Range: The ADG1433YRUZ-REEL7 is designed to operate within an industrial temperature range of -40°C to +125°C, ensuring reliability in harsh environments.

Product Packaging
The ADG1433YRUZ-REEL7 comes in a compact 16-lead TSSOP (Thin Shrink Small Outline Package) and is supplied in 7-inch reels, making it ideal for automated manufacturing processes. The REEL7 suffix indicates the product is provided in tape and reel packaging, which is essential for high-volume, surface-mount assembly lines.
